08. Multi-Signature Wallets: Collective Security for Crypto Assets

Multi-signature wallets enhance cryptocurrency security by requiring multiple approvals for transactions, decentralizing control and reducing risks, making them essential for businesses and individual asset management in the blockchain ecosystem.

1

Introduction

In the evolving landscape of cryptocurrency, security remains a paramount concern. Multi-signature wallets, commonly known as multisig wallets, have emerged as a critical solution in enhancing the security of digital assets. These wallets require multiple keys to authorize a single transaction, thereby distributing trust among multiple parties and significantly reducing the risk of theft or unauthorized access.

Multi-signature technology addresses a fundamental flaw in the traditional single-key wallets: the single point of failure. If a hacker gains access to a single private key, they can control all the assets within that wallet. Multi-signature wallets mitigate this risk by requiring two or more keys to agree on a transaction before executing it. This setup is particularly beneficial for businesses or groups where funds need collective oversight, ensuring no single individual can transfer assets without other parties' consensus.

The importance of multi-signature wallets extends beyond just security. They also play a crucial role in streamlining business operations and governance within crypto enterprises by enforcing checks and balances on transaction approvals. As such, multi-signature technology secures assets against external threats and fortifies internal controls, making it an indispensable tool in modern cryptocurrency management.

2

How Multi-Signature Wallets Work

Multi-signature (multisig) technology is an advanced security feature that protects blockchain transactions. Unlike traditional wallets, which require just one key to authorize a transaction, multisig wallets require multiple keys to approve the same action. This approach enhances security by distributing control over the assets among several parties.

Mechanics of Multi-Signature Technology: At its core, multi-signature technology involves creating a wallet with multiple private keys, where a predefined number of keys must sign off on any transaction before it can be executed on the blockchain. This is set up through a smart contract that defines the rules for the transaction process. Each key holder must use their private key to sign the transaction independently. The transaction only proceeds if the required signatures are collected, effectively vetting and securing each action.

Types of Multi-Signature Configurations:

  1. 2-of-3: This is one of the most common multisig configurations. In a 2-of-3 setup, there are three possible vital holders, but only two are needed to approve a transaction. This model is ideal for small businesses or partnerships where you want to prevent errors or fraud by requiring two out of three partners to agree on a transaction. It’s also useful for backup purposes—if one key is lost, the remaining two can still secure and access the funds.
  2. 3-of-5: This configuration involves five keys; any three are required to authorize a transaction. It is suitable for larger organizations or investment groups with more consensus to execute transactions. This setup provides a good balance between security and flexibility, as it disperses power more broadly among participants and ensures that a higher number of stakeholders are involved in the decision-making process.

Application Scenarios:

  • Corporate Governance: In a corporate environment, multisig wallets can enforce corporate governance by requiring multiple department heads or executives to approve significant financial transactions, thereby preventing unauthorized spending or embezzlement.
  • Estate Planning: For personal asset management, multisig can be used to ensure that multiple family members agree before any inheritance is disbursed.
  • Escrow Services: A multisig wallet can act as a neutral third party in transactions requiring escrow. For example, in a 2-of-3 escrow setup, the buyer, seller, and escrow agent hold one key, and at least two must agree to release funds.

By requiring multiple approvals, multi-signature wallets provide a robust solution to security concerns in the cryptocurrency space, making them a critical tool for managing and safeguarding digital assets in various settings. This configuration minimizes the risk of theft or unauthorized access and reinforces accountability and transparency among stakeholders.

3

Advantages of Multi-Signature Wallets

Multi-signature wallets offer a sophisticated approach to managing and securing digital assets. Their structural design inherently provides several significant benefits, enhancing security and reducing operational risks. Below are the primary advantages of employing multi-signature technology.

Enhanced Security: The most evident benefit of multi-signature wallets is their heightened security. These wallets drastically reduce the risks associated with single-key wallets by requiring multiple keys to authorize any single transaction. Multi-signature wallets prevent unauthorized access in scenarios where one key is compromised because the attacker would still need additional keys to execute any transaction. This multiple-key requirement is akin to having several layers of security, making it exceedingly difficult for potential attackers to gain control over the assets.

Reduced Risk of Errors and Fraud: Multi-signature setups naturally mitigate the risk of errors and fraudulent activities. Since multiple parties need to confirm each transaction, catching any mistaken or malicious attempts becomes easier before they are processed. This is especially crucial in environments where large sums are frequently moved, as it ensures higher scrutiny and verification from multiple trusted sources.

Operational Transparency: Multi-signature wallets foster a transparent operational environment. By involving multiple stakeholders in the approval process, each transaction is subjected to oversight, thus promoting transparency. This is particularly important in business settings, where shareholders or various departments must handle funds appropriately.

Decentralization of Control: In traditional single-signature setups, a single control point can lead to power imbalances and potential misuse of funds. Multi-signature wallets decentralize control, distributing power among multiple parties. This distribution enhances security and aligns with the decentralized ethos of blockchain technology, making it ideal for organizations aiming to reduce centralized risks.

Importance in Business and Group Fund Management: Multi-signature wallets are instrumental in managing funds securely and efficiently for businesses and groups. They are crucial for:

  • Corporate Governance: Ensuring that significant financial decisions are made collectively is essential for compliance and internal controls.
  • Joint Ventures and Partnerships: Facilitating collaboration where capital investment is pooled from various parties, requiring consensus on financial decisions.
  • Non-Profits and Foundations: Enhancing accountability in financial operations is vital for organizations that handle donations or manage funds on behalf of beneficiaries.

Backup and Recovery: Multi-signature wallets offer robust solutions for backup and recovery scenarios. In cases where one keyholder might lose access to their key, other keyholders can still secure the assets, preventing total loss and ensuring continuity of access.

In summary, multi-signature wallets are not just a security tool but a comprehensive system that enhances operational integrity, transparency, and accountability. These characteristics make them invaluable in individual asset management and complex organizational financial operations, ensuring assets are safeguarded and properly administered.

4

Setting Up and Using Multi-Signature Wallets

Setting up and using a multi-signature wallet involves careful consideration and adherence to best practices to ensure the security and efficiency of your crypto assets. Here's a detailed guide on selecting, setting up, and managing a multi-signature wallet.

Selecting a Multi-Signature Wallet:

  1. Evaluate Security Features: Choose a wallet known for strong security measures. Look for features like two-factor authentication, secure key generation, and a transparent security track record.
  2. Assess Compatibility: Ensure the wallet supports the cryptocurrencies you intend to use and is compatible with your operating system.
  3. User Experience: Since multi-signature setups can be complex, opt for a wallet with a user-friendly interface that simplifies the management of multiple keys.
  4. Community and Developer Support: Select a wallet with active community support and ongoing developer involvement to keep up with the latest security enhancements and features.
  5. Examples of Recommended Wallets: Consider using established wallets like Electrum, which offers customization for multi-signature setups, or BitGo, known for its high-security features and enterprise solutions.

Setting Up the Wallet:

  1. Installation: Download the wallet software from a trusted source and install it on your device. Ensure your device is secure and free from malware.
  2. Creating the Wallet: Choose the multi-signature option during setup. Most wallets will allow you to select the configuration, such as 2-of-3 or 3-of-5, depending on how many signatures will be required to approve transactions.
  3. Generating Keys: Each participant must securely generate their private and public keys. Private keys must be generated and stored in a secure environment.
  4. Sharing Public Keys: Share only the public keys with the other participants to set up the wallet. The sharing of private keys should never occur.
  5. Finalizing Setup: Input all the necessary public keys into the wallet to configure the multi-signature settings. Complete any additional steps as directed by wallet software.

Best Practices for Managing Multi-Signature Wallets:

  1. Secure Key Storage: Each participant should store their private key securely, possibly using hardware wallets or secure offline storage solutions to minimize exposure to online threats.
  2. Transaction Protocols: Establish clear protocols for transaction verification. This should include independent verification of transaction details by each signer before approval.
  3. Regular Audits: Conduct regular audits of wallet activity and security practices. This helps detect security vulnerabilities or unauthorized activities early on.
  4. Access Control: Define who can initiate transactions and under what circumstances. All participants should understand and be familiar with this governance structure.
  5. Education and Training: Ensure all participants know the risks and procedures associated with multi-signature wallets. Regular training can help prevent mistakes and enhance security.

By following these guidelines, you can effectively set up and manage a multi-signature wallet, leveraging its benefits to secure your digital assets while mitigating the risks associated with single-user wallets.

5

Risks and Challenges of Multi-Signature Wallets

Multi-signature wallets are renowned for bolstering security and providing operational resilience in managing digital assets. However, they also introduce specific risks and challenges that require careful consideration and strategic management to ensure effective and secure use.

Complexity of Configuration: One of the primary risks associated with multi-signature wallets is the complexity involved in their setup and use. Incorrect configuration of a multi-signature wallet can lead to scenarios where transactions cannot be executed due to mismanagement of the required number of approvals or incorrect distribution of keys. For example, setting up a 3-of-5 wallet but only regularly using three keys can result in losing access if one key is compromised or lost.

Key Management Issues: Effective key management is crucial in a multi-signature setup. Each participant must securely manage their private key. If a single key is lost or stolen, it can compromise the entire wallet's security or cause it to lose access to the funds, depending on its configuration. Additionally, coordinating between multiple parties to sign a transaction can be cumbersome and time-consuming, which could delay critical transactions.

Security of Individual Keys: While the multi-signature setup inherently disperses risk, each key must be secured independently. If an attacker compromises one key, they might not access the funds directly. Still, they could use it as a leverage point to access additional keys through social engineering or other means.

Best Practices to Overcome These Challenges:

  1. Thorough Planning and Testing: Before fully implementing a multi-signature wallet, thoroughly plan the configuration and test the setup in a controlled environment. This includes simulating recovery scenarios to ensure that all contingencies are covered.
  2. Robust Key Management Protocols: Implement strict protocols for generating, storing, and recovering private keys. Consider using hardware wallets to store keys to reduce online theft risk. Additionally, establish clear procedures for key rotation and revocation in case a key is compromised.
  3. Transparent Governance and Standard Operating Procedures (SOPs): Define clear governance rules that outline who holds keys and how transactions are initiated, verified, and approved. Create detailed SOPs for regular and emergency operations to ensure consistency and security in everyday operations.
  4. Regular Security Audits and Updates: Regularly audit the security practices surrounding the multi-signature wallet, including reviewing who has access to keys and how transactions are processed. Keep the wallet software and associated infrastructure updated to protect against new vulnerabilities.
  5. Education and Continuous Improvement: Educate all critical holders on the risks and best practices associated with multi-signature wallets. Encourage ongoing improvement and adaptation of strategies as new threats and technologies emerge.

By addressing these risks and implementing stringent management practices, users can harness the full potential of multi-signature wallets to secure their digital assets effectively. This proactive approach to risk management is essential in leveraging the benefits of advanced cryptographic solutions like multi-signature technology.

Future Outlook

The future of multi-signature technology is poised for significant growth, driven by its critical role in enhancing cryptocurrency security and streamlining corporate governance. As blockchain technology continues to mature, we can expect broader adoption of multi-signature wallets across various sectors, including finance, legal, and healthcare, where secure, decentralized management of assets is paramount. Innovations may include more seamless integration with emerging technologies such as smart contracts and decentralized finance (DeFi) platforms, offering even greater automation and flexibility in transaction approval processes. This evolution will likely foster even more robust security frameworks and governance models, making multi-signature technology a standard practice in digital asset management.

About Cwallet

Cwallet is a leading crypto wallet offering secure, fast, and flexible solutions for all your crypto needs.

Supporting over 800 cryptocurrencies and more than 50 blockchain networks, Cwallet is the preferred choice for millions of users worldwide. Our platform combines custodial and non-custodial wallets, offering the best blend of security and convenience. At Cwallet, we're dedicated to simplifying the cryptocurrency world and delivering an exceptional user experience.